The ASUS ProArt PA329CRV is a 32-inch 4K IPS monitor offering factory-calibrated color accuracy, 98 % DCI-P3 coverage and robust USB-C connectivity, but its HDR brightness and refresh rate remain modest.

The Dell UltraSharp U2415 is a 24.1-inch professional IPS monitor with excellent color accuracy, robust ergonomics, and a versatile connectivity suite. While it excels for design and office work, its older 1080p-plus resolution and lack of modern features like HDR limit its appeal for newer multimedia demands.

Reviewers commend the accurate colors and wide gamut, while noting the limited HDR brightness and lack of a built-in KVM as drawbacks.
Users love the out-of-the-box color accuracy and USB-C convenience, but miss a built-in KVM and wish for brighter HDR.
